Beef
Pljeskavica
A Balkan-style patty made from spiced ground beef or pork, grilled and served with flatbread.

Pho
A fragrant noodle soup with beef or chicken, served with herbs and lime.
Asado
A traditional Argentine barbecue featuring beef, chorizo, and other meats cooked over an open flame.
Rendang
A rich and slow-cooked beef stew with coconut milk and aromatic spices.
Empanadas
Savory pastries filled with spiced meat, cheese, or vegetables, baked or fried.
Suya
Spiced grilled meat skewers served with a peanut dipping sauce.
Chivito
A sandwich filled with steak, ham, cheese, and fried eggs.

Padang Satay
Skewered and grilled beef served with a rich peanut sauce.

Kjøttkaker
Meatballs made with spiced ground meat, often served with brown sauce and potatoes.

Bandeja Paisa
A platter with grilled steak, fried egg, rice, beans, and plantains.
Manty
Dumplings stuffed with spiced meat, often served with yogurt sauce.
Khinkali
Juicy dumplings filled with spiced meat, often eaten with hands to enjoy the broth inside.
Nihari
A slow-cooked stew of beef or lamb, flavored with ginger, garlic, and spices.
Bobotie
A baked dish of spiced minced meat topped with an egg-based custard.
Ropa Vieja
Shredded beef stew cooked with tomatoes, onions, and bell peppers.
Mici
Grilled minced meat rolls seasoned with garlic and spices.
Nyama Choma
Grilled meat, typically goat or beef, served with ugali and kachumbari salad.
Svickova
Marinated beef served with a creamy vegetable sauce and bread dumplings.
Bulgogi
Thinly sliced beef marinated in soy sauce, garlic, and sugar, then grilled or stir-fried.
Empanadas de Pino
Savory pastries filled with ground beef, onions, olives, and boiled eggs.
